FAQ

Common questions about K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E

What does the Chief Executive Officer of K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E earn?

In 2024, the Chief Executive Officer of K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E received $351,653 in total compensation. This pay is in the top quarter for Chief Executive Officer roles among Science & Technology organizations nationwide, though not the top 10% of comparable filings. Based on IRS Form 990 data.

How does Chief Executive Officer pay at K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E compare with similar nonprofits?

Compared with the same role at Science & Technology organizations nationwide, the 2024 pay of the Chief Executive Officer at K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E falls between the 75th and 90th percentiles. In 2024, the highest total compensation at K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E equaled 8% of the organization's total expenses. The median for science & technology organizations is 9%.

What are K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E's revenue and expenses?

In 2024, KANSAS HEALTH INSTITUTE reported $4.4M in total revenue and $4.4M in total expenses on its IRS Form 990.
